Ah sorry, I assumed you inserted the video yourself.
If you want to extract the video as a separate file, you can
- make a copy of the PPT file
- change the extension of the copy from .pptx to .zip
- double click the zip file
- open folder 'ppt' >> open folder 'media'
- the video should be in that folder >> you can see what file type it is, maybe try to re-insert it on the slide etc.

You can also try RIGHT click on the video > save as Media and the file name should give an indication of the file type.
